Output bbb924ddd4e3e40371fa4f44f169b65245274cde26a70dd8dfd2c16d4e12029a:1

value
4670162
script pubkey
OP_0 OP_PUSHBYTES_32 de15ee64ad7895e1a3982d3b5c55309fb62ef4dc127e863e5544145a0bb47dce
address
bc1qmc27ue9d0z27rguc95a4c4fsn7mzaaxuzflgv0j4gs295za50h8quyfty4
transaction
bbb924ddd4e3e40371fa4f44f169b65245274cde26a70dd8dfd2c16d4e12029a
confirmations
19450
spent
true